Revenue and income statement
In 2023, TRANSEXPRESS62 achieves revenue of 1.0 M€. Revenue is growing positively over 6 years (CAGR: +0.7%). Vs 2022, growth of +12% (929 k€ -> 1.0 M€). After deducting consumption (0 €), gross margin stands at 1.0 M€, i.e. a rate of 100%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ches -26 k€, representing -2.5% of revenue. Positive scissor effect: EBITDA margin improves by +3.6 pts, sign of improved operational efficiency. Negative EBITDA means operations do not cover current expenses: concerning situation. Net income is negative at -9 k€ (-0.8% of revenue), which will impact equity.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 60 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 27 days. The gap of 33 days means the company finances its customers for over a month before being paid relative to supplier payments. This weighs on cash flow. Overall, WCR represents 42 days of revenue, i.e. 123 k€ to permanently finance. Notable WCR improvement over the period (-32%), freeing up cash.
